why was omnicef discontinued
Omnicef (cefdinir) is a cephalosporin antibiotic used to treat many different types of infections caused by bacteria. The brand name Omnicef is discontinued in the U.S. Omnicef is available in generic form.

Is cefdinir hard on the kidneys?
Appropriate studies performed to date have not demonstrated geriatric-specific problems that would limit the usefulness of cefdinir in the elderly. However, elderly patients are more likely to have age-related kidney problems, which may require caution and an adjustment in the dose for patients receiving cefdinir.
What is strongest antibiotic for sinus infection?
Amoxicillin remains the drug of choice for acute, uncomplicated bacterial sinusitis. Amoxicillin is most effective when given frequently enough to sustain adequate levels in the infected tissue. While often prescribed twice daily, it is even more effective if taken in 3 or 4 divided doses.

What is similar to cefdinir?
Cefdinir is an oral antibiotic in the cephalosporin family of antibiotics. The cephalosporin family includes cephalexin (Keflex), cefaclor (Ceclor), cefuroxime (Zinacef), cefpodoxime (Vantin), cefixime (Suprax), and cefprozil (Cefzil).

Is Omnicef and Augmentin the same?
Omnicef and Augmentin are different types of antibiotics. Omnicef is a cephalosporin antibiotic and Augmentin is a combination of a penicillin-type antibiotic and a beta-lactamase inhibitor.

What are the side effects of Omnicef?
Common side effects of Omnicef include:
diarrhea,nausea,vomiting,stomach pain,indigestion,headache,dizziness,diaper rash in an infant taking liquid cefdinir,

What can you not take with cefdinir?
If you are taking aluminum or magnesium-containing antacids, iron supplements, or multivitamins, do not take them at the same time that you take this medicine. It is best to take these medicines at least 2 hours before or after taking cefdinir. These medicines may keep cefdinir from working properly.
